Spike In Fuel Prices Erasing Airline Profits

送信時刻:
 
Soaring jet fuel prices are wiping out profits at the nation's biggest airlines. United Continental Holdings Inc. lost $213 million in the first quarter after its fuel bill jumped by $560 million, the world's biggest airline company said on Thursday. Southwest and JetBlue both scratched out tiny profits despite higher fuel costs. (www.nbcmontana.com) さらに...
